#557a9c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#557a9c is composed of 33.3% red, 47.8%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.5% cyan, 21.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 208.7 degrees, a saturation of 29.5% and a lightness of 47.3%. #557a9c color hex could be obtained by blending #aaf4ff with #000039.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#557a9c color description : Dark moderate blue.
#557a9c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#557a9c has RGB values of R:85, G:122,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0.22, Y:0,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 5601948.

Shades and Tints of #557a9c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020304 is the darkest color, while #f6f8f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#557a9c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#717980 is the less saturated color, while #027eef is the most saturated one.
